Description
Hardware and Performance Specifications Auxiliary supply: Powered via CEX‑bus, typical 200 mA @24 V DC Signal types: Intrinsically‑safe 4‑20 mA analog signals, binary digital signals for Ex‑field transmitters and sensors Bus interface: CEX optical bus for communication with S800 I/O modules Mounting mode: DIN‑rail mounting unit Protection class: IP20 Operating temperature: +5 ℃ ~ +55 ℃ Storage temperature: ‑40 ℃ ~ +70 ℃ Humidity: 5‑95 %RH non‑condensing Environment compliance: ISA 71.04 G3 corrosion‑resistant standard Certifications: ATEX intrinsic‑safety certification, CE, DNV‑GL marine certification Dimension & weight: approx. 225 × 120 × 60 mm, weight approx. 0.75 kg
Main Functions Realize intrinsically‑safe signal marshalling wiring for field instruments in hazardous areas. Provide reinforced electrical isolation between explosion‑risk‑field side and safe‑area control‑system side, satisfy Ex‑ia/ib intrinsic‑safety requirements. Process 4‑20 mA analog and binary digital signals from field sensors and transmitters. Transmit field‑site signal data to S800 I/O modules through CEX optical bus. Pluggable terminal blocks for convenient field wiring, module replacement without rewiring field cables. Front‑panel LED indicators for bus‑link status and module fault indication. Hardware self‑diagnosis detects bus‑communication failure and internal circuit faults, and reports fault status to AC 800xA control system. Parameter configuration and diagnosis are completed by ABB Control Builder engineering software.
Installation Requirement DIN‑rail installation inside safe‑area control cabinet. Strictly separate hazardous‑area intrinsically‑safe cables and non‑intrinsically‑safe power‑cable wiring according to Ex‑installation specifications. Ensure reliable cabinet protective grounding. After unit replacement, confirm full part‑number 3BDH000741R1 matches original project configuration, download complete system configuration file. Perform CEX‑optical‑bus communication test and signal‑loop verification. This Ex‑interface unit cannot be substituted by ordinary non‑Ex terminal modules. Do not put into service until no hardware self‑diagnosis fault alarm exists.
Typical Application Scenarios Intrinsically‑safe terminal‑interface spare‑part for ABB AC 800xA S800 I/O system, used for signal marshalling in petrochemical, oil‑gas, chemical‑plant hazardous‑area automation‑control‑system maintenance and spare‑part replacement.
Key Features
- Dedicated intrinsically‑safe terminal‑interface unit for S800 I/O system, meets ATEX intrinsic‑safety standards for explosive‑hazardous‑area applications.
- Adopt CEX optical‑bus communication, effectively suppress strong‑electromagnetic‑field interference in industrial‑site environment.
- Pluggable terminal‑block design, reduce field‑rewiring workload during module replacement.
- G3‑grade anti‑corrosion hardware design, adapt to harsh chemical‑plant site environment.
- Strict full‑part‑number matching must be followed during spare‑part replacement; ordinary non‑Ex modules cannot replace CTI21‑P Ex.
